Ripple Expands Payments Platform as XRP Consolidates Near $1.33 Support

Ripple announced on March 4, 2026, a major expansion of its Ripple Payments platform, transforming it into a full-stack infrastructure layer enabling businesses to collect, hold, exchange, and pay out in both fiat currencies and stablecoins through a single integrated provider.

The new capabilities, powered by recent acquisitions Palisade and Rail, consolidate custody, treasury automation, virtual accounts, conversion, and settlement across 60 markets, with the platform having now processed more than $100 billion in total volume amid accelerating global stablecoin adoption. Ripple Payments Expands to Full-Stack Stablecoin Infrastructure

Ripple is no longer solely focused on cross-border payments but now positions itself as a comprehensive infrastructure provider for digital asset money movement. The expanded Ripple Payments platform allows businesses to avoid stitching together separate vendors for custody, collections, conversion, and settlement, instead accessing all capabilities through a single integration.

Two recent acquisitions power the new functionality. Palisade, which handles custody and treasury automation, enables the managed custody layer that lets businesses provision wallets at scale and sweep funds into operational accounts. Rail, a virtual accounts and collections platform, enables businesses to accept fiat and stablecoin pay-ins through named virtual accounts with automated conversion and settlement.

The result consolidates what previously required multiple providers—custody, foreign exchange, stablecoin liquidity, and local payout rails—into one platform with a single integration. This positions Ripple to serve fintechs and financial institutions seeking infrastructure that treats digital assets with the same operational rigor as traditional finance.

$100 Billion Volume Milestone and Market Context

Ripple reported that the platform has now processed more than $100 billion in total volume, a milestone achieved against a backdrop of accelerating stablecoin adoption across the global financial system. Annual stablecoin transaction volumes reached $33 trillion in 2025, with stablecoins now accounting for approximately 30 percent of all onchain transaction volume.

The expansion comes at a time when XRP price has been under pressure, down approximately 5 percent over the past week amid broader market sell-offs driven by U.S.-Iran conflict. However, Ripple’s payments business operates largely independently of XRP’s spot price, and the institutional adoption trajectory suggests enterprise strategy is gaining traction regardless of token market performance.

President Monica Long stated that for the global financial system to evolve, fintechs and financial institutions need infrastructure that treats digital assets with the same rigor as traditional finance. Ripple has built the blueprint for blockchain-based enterprise solutions designed to operate at global scale for regulated finance.

XRP Price Technical Analysis: Consolidation Near Critical Support

XRP failed to sustain levels above $1.40 and has entered a downside correction, currently trading below $1.3750 and the 100-hourly Simple Moving Average. A new bearish trend line has formed with resistance at $1.3880 on the hourly chart.

The price dipped below the 50 percent Fibonacci retracement level of the upward move from the $1.2702 swing low to the $1.4330 high. Bulls remain active above the $1.3320 zone, which represents the 61.8 percent Fibonacci retracement level and serves as critical near-term support.

If XRP can hold above $1.3320, a fresh upward move may attempt to clear resistance near $1.370, with major resistance at $1.3880 and $1.40. A clear move above $1.40 could send the price toward $1.4320 and potentially $1.45, with the next major hurdle near $1.50.

However, failure to clear the $1.3880 resistance zone could trigger a fresh decline. Initial downside support sits at $1.3320, followed by $1.3085. A downside break and close below $1.3085 could open the path toward $1.2880, with next major support at $1.2650 and $1.250.

Technical indicators show the hourly MACD losing pace in the bullish zone, while the hourly RSI remains below the 50 level, suggesting neutral to slightly bearish momentum in the near term.
